Question 603105: Determine the probability of p(x>108) with a mean of 100 and a standard deviation of 8
Answer by stanbon(75887)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Determine the probability of p(x>108) with a mean of 100 and a standard deviation of 8
----
z(108) = (108-100)/8 = 1
---
P(x > 108) = P(z > 1) = 0.1587
